SOURCE: on a GE monogram oven, one row of buttons don't
This sounds like a faulty control panel. This is most likely a failed Oven Control.
I would advise that a reputable GE authorized servicer verify fault and repair this type of oven.
Wall ovens are potentially more complicated to service than a free standing range and many servicers actually prefer not to deal with a wall oven at all.
It could be something as simple as a cracked trace or solder joint, but you would have to disassemble it and inspect it carefully to determine that, and it might be possible to be resoldered. Otherwise, it will need to be replaced to restore functionality.
